Comment ajouter un en-tête de sécurité dans soapUI ?

Comment ajouter un en-tête de sécurité dans soapUI ? Cliquez avec le bouton droit n’importe où dans la fenêtre principale des exigences pour ouvrir un menu. Sélectionnez WSS sortant >> Appliquer le jeton de nom d’utilisateur OLSA. Cela ajoute les informations d’en-tête de sécurité à la demande d’enveloppe de savon.

Comment ajouter un en-tête dans WSDL ? Vous pouvez ajouter des informations d’en-tête Soap aux appels de méthode en décorant les méthodes dans la classe proxy générée à partir du WSDL avec l’attribut SoapHeader. Par exemple, wsdl.exe génère une référence de classe de proxy client. cs pour la référence du service Web lorsque vous sélectionnez Ajouter une référence Web.

Qu’est-ce qu’un en-tête SOAP ? Le SOAP est un élément facultatif dans un message SOAP. Il est utilisé pour transmettre des informations liées à l’application à traiter par les nœuds SOAP le long du chemin du message. Les blocs d’en-tête SOAP peuvent être traités par les nœuds intermédiaires SOAP et par le nœud récepteur SOAP final.

Qu’est-ce qu’une requête et une réponse SOAP ? La spécification SOAP décrit une manière standard, basée sur XML, d’encoder les requêtes et les réponses, y compris : Les requêtes pour invoquer une méthode sur un service, y compris dans les paramètres. Réponses d’une méthode de service, y compris la valeur de retour et les paramètres sortants. erreur d’un service.

Comment configurer SoapUI ? Étape 1 – Configurez soapUI et la boîte à outils OLSA.

Une fois ouvert, sélectionnez Fichier >> Nouveau projet SOAP. 2. Dans la nouvelle fenêtre, il vous sera demandé de fournir les détails de votre projet. Donnez un nom à votre projet, puis entrez l’emplacement du fichier wsdl pour votre site Skillport.

Table des matières

Comment ajouter un en-tête de sécurité dans soapUI ? – D’autres questions

Comment ajouter des propriétés dans SoapUI ?

Propriétés personnalisées dans SoapUI

1. Cliquez avec le bouton droit sur l’étape de test, puis cliquez sur Ajouter une étape en surbrillance, puis sélectionnez Propriétés. 3. Après avoir fourni un nom logique, SoapUI affichera l’écran ci-dessous pour ajouter les propriétés du scénario de test.

Qu’est-ce qu’un fichier WSDL dans SOAP ?

WSDL ou Web Service Description Language est un langage de définition basé sur XML. Il est utilisé pour décrire la fonctionnalité d’un service Web basé sur SOAP. Les fichiers WSDL jouent un rôle central dans le test des services basés sur SOAP. SoapUI utilise des fichiers WSDL pour générer des demandes de test, des assertions et des services fictifs.

Qu’est-ce qu’un en-tête de service Web ?

L’en-tête est un élément facultatif qui peut contenir des informations supplémentaires transmises au service Web. Body est un élément obligatoire et contient des données spécifiques à la méthode de service Web appelée. Lorsque l’élément Header est utilisé pour transmettre des informations sur la manière dont le contenu du corps SOAP doit être traité par le service Web.

Quelle est l’exigence d’en-tête SOAP ?

L’en-tête SOAP contient des entrées d’en-tête définies dans un espace de noms. L’en-tête est codé comme le premier enfant immédiat de l’enveloppe SOAP. Si plusieurs en-têtes sont définis, tous les enfants immédiats de l’en-tête SOAP sont interprétés comme des blocs d’en-tête SOAP.

Qu’est-ce que l’attribut mustUnderstand dans l’en-tête SOAP ?

L’attribut mustUnderstand

L’attribut SOAP mustUnderstand peut être utilisé pour indiquer si une entrée d’en-tête est obligatoire ou facultative pour le traitement par le récepteur. L’ajout de mustUnderstand= »1″ à un enfant de l’élément d’en-tête signifie que le récepteur qui traite l’en-tête doit reconnaître l’élément.

Que doit comprendre l’attribut dans l’en-tête SOAP ?

L’attribut mustUnderstand est utilisé pour attirer l’attention sur le fait que la sémantique d’un élément diffère de la sémantique de ses éléments parents ou homologues. Pour un en-tête dont l’attribut mustUnderstand est défini sur true, si l’acteur ne peut pas traiter l’en-tête, il doit renvoyer une erreur SOAP à l’expéditeur.

Lire  Qu'entendez-vous par tableau en Visual Basic ?

SOAP peut-il utiliser JSON ?

SOAP peut utiliser JSON pour la communication, mais l’inverse n’est pas du tout possible. SOAP utilise le format XML tandis que JSON utilise une paire clé-valeur. Le message d’erreur peut être déclaré avec SOAP, mais la même chose ne peut pas être faite avec JSON.

Quand les tests d’API sont-ils effectués ?

Un test d’API est généralement effectué en faisant des requêtes à un ou plusieurs points de terminaison d’API et en comparant la réponse aux résultats attendus. Les tests d’API sont souvent automatisés et utilisés par DevOps, l’assurance qualité (QA) et les équipes de développement pour des pratiques de test continues.

Que sont les paramètres TLS ?

Transport Layer Security (TLS), le successeur du Secure Sockets Layer (SSL) désormais obsolète, est un protocole cryptographique conçu pour assurer la sécurité des communications sur un réseau informatique. Le protocole TLS vise principalement à assurer la confidentialité et l’intégrité des données entre deux ou plusieurs applications informatiques communicantes.

Qu’est-ce qu’une version TLS ?

TLS, abréviation de Transport Layer Security, et SSL, abréviation de Secure Socket Layers, sont deux protocoles cryptographiques qui chiffrent les données et authentifient une connexion lorsque les données se déplacent sur Internet. Puis, en 1999, la première version de TLS (1.0) a été publiée en tant que mise à niveau vers SSL 3.0.

Soap utilise-t-il TLS ?

Les clients SOAP Gateway peuvent sécuriser l’échange de données avec SOAP Gateway sur des requêtes HTTPS à l’aide du protocole de sécurité SSL/TLS. Vous pouvez utiliser l’application IBM® z/OS® Communications Server et la fonction AT-TLS (Transparent Transport Layer Security) SAF pour sécuriser la connexion.

Quelles propriétés sont disponibles dans SoapUI ?

SoapUI utilise souvent des propriétés personnalisées pour stocker des valeurs personnalisées dans un projet. Une « propriété » est une valeur de chaîne nommée (actuellement, toutes les propriétés sont traitées comme des chaînes) accessible à partir d’un script, d’un transfert de propriété ou d’une extension de propriété.

Comment passer plusieurs valeurs dans SoapUI ?

1 réponse. Ouvrez l’interface utilisateur SOAP et accédez aux propriétés de la demande, accédez à Délimiteur de valeurs multiples et définissez une valeur, par exemple une virgule (,), puis vous pouvez mettre des valeurs séparées par des virgules dans la valeur réelle.

Qu’est-ce que l’URL du point de terminaison dans SoapUI ?

Qu’est-ce que l’URL du point de terminaison dans SoapUI ?

Lire  Qu'est-ce qu'un conteneur Springboot ?

Quelle est la différence entre SOAP et WSDL ?

SOAP (Simple Object Access Protocol) est essentiellement la spécification de protocole de messagerie basée sur XML utilisée pour échanger des informations claires et structurées lors de la mise en œuvre de services Web sur des réseaux informatiques, tandis que WSDL (Web Services Description Language) est un langage de définition d’interface basé sur XML Pro

WSDL est-il obligatoire pour SOAP ?

2 réponses. SOAP peut être utilisé sans WSDL, mais ces services ne sont pas trouvés en utilisant les mécanismes de détection offerts par WSDL. WSDL pourrait être utilisé pour décrire toute forme d’échange XML entre deux nœuds. Les services REST peuvent être décrits à l’aide de WSDL version 2.0.

Est-ce que WSDL SOAP ou REST ?

SOAP utilise WSDL pour la communication consommateur-fournisseur, tandis que REST utilise uniquement XML ou JSON pour envoyer et recevoir des données. WSDL définit le contrat entre le client et le service et est de nature statique. SOAP décrit les fonctions et les types de données.

Quels sont les en-têtes dans l’API REST ?

Les en-têtes et paramètres REST contiennent une multitude d’informations qui peuvent vous aider à détecter les problèmes lorsque vous les rencontrez. Les en-têtes HTTP sont une partie importante de la demande et de la réponse API car ils représentent les métadonnées associées à la demande et à la réponse API.

Quelles sont les 2 manières de lier un message SOAP ?

WSDL distingue deux styles de message : Document et RPC. Le style de message affecte le contenu du corps SOAP : Style de document : Le corps SOAP contient un ou plusieurs éléments enfants appelés parties.

Quel élément doit être inclus dans le document SOAP ?

Chaque message SOAP a un élément d’enveloppe racine. L’enveloppe est une partie obligatoire du message SOAP. Chaque élément Envelope doit contenir exactement un élément Body.